Sarojini Sahoo Biography

Sarojini Sahoo is a noted woman writer from Orissa known for feminist works. She is also a popular columnist in The New Indian Express and associate editor of Chennai based English magazine Indian AGE. Apart from her mother tongue, she also writes in English language. She is the wife of Jagadish Mohanty, a veteran writer of Odisha and the couple has two kids. She has published eight novels in Oriya and ten anthologies of short stories, belonging to Oriya and English languages. She has also published one anthology work of short stories in Hindi - Rape Tatha Anya Kahaniyana (2010). She has published a collection of essays Sensible Sensuality in the year 2010. Her novel Gambhiri Ghara, the best instance of her feminist outlook was a bestseller. Her works are related to sexuality and sexual frankness.

 

Sahoo was born on 4 January 1956 to Ishwar Chandra Sahoo and Nalini Devi in the small town of Dhenkanal. MA and PhD degrees in Oriya Literature and a Bachelor of Law from Utkal University are her educational qualifications. At present she works as a college lecturer in Belpahar, Jharsuguda. Her English anthologies of short stories are Sarojini Sahoo Stories (2006) and Waiting for Manna (2008).

 

Her Oriya anthologies of short stories are Sukhara Muhanmuhin (1981), Nija GahirareNije (1989),    Amrutara Pratikshare (1992), Chowkath (1994), Tarali Jauthiba Durga (1995), Deshantari (1999), Dukha Apramita (2006) and Srujani Sarojini (2008). Upanibesh (1998), Pratibandi (1999), Swapna Khojali Mane (2000), Mahajatra (2001), Gambhiri Ghara (2005), Bishad Ishwari (2006), Pakshibasa (2007) and   Asamajik (2008) are her Oriya novels. She is often regarded as a trendsetter of feminism in contemporary Oriya literature. She has received several awards including Sahitya acdemy award, Ladli Media Award, Prajatantra Award, Bhubaneswar Book Fair Award and Jhankar award.
